
Cleola Davis
Cleola Davis is a U.S. Army veteran and author of Forged in Battle: African American Officers Serving in the United States Army.
Her work documents the stories of African American officers whose leadership and sacrifice shaped military history.
Cleola did not begin as a writer.
She began with a responsibility.
After encouragement from a fellow service member who completed the program, she joined with hesitation, but also with conviction that these stories deserved to be preserved.
